Synopsis "La Transformación (in Spanish)"

In Franz Kafka’s most celebrated novel about the alienation one can feel in everyday life, young traveling salesman Gregor Samsa wakes up one morning to find that he has transformed into a repulsive insect. His parents and sister are terrified, not only of the oversized creature but also of their own fates, because Gregor had been paying off his father’s debt and providing money for them to live off of. They are forced to find jobs, and as they adjust to their new life and transformed cohabitant, their treatment of Gregor varies, from attempting to feed him to running away from him to ignoring him entirely. Written in 1912, The Metamorphosis has remained one of the great works of modern literature due to its unique premise and biting insights into family life. En la novela más célebre de Franz Kafka sobre la alienación que se puede sentir en la vida diaria, el joven viajante de comercio Gregor Samsa despierta una mañana convertido en un repulsivo insecto. Sus padres y su hermana están aterrorizados, no sólo por la criatura de gran tamaño pero también por sus propios destinos, porque Gregor había estado pagando las deudas de su padre y proporcionando dinero para que pudieran vivir. Se ven sin más remedio que encontrar trabajo, y mientras se adaptan a una vida nueva y su transformado conviviente, su tratamiento de Gregor varía, desde tratar de darle de comer hasta huir de él y no hacerle ningún caso. Escrito en 1912, La transformación ha sido uno de los grandes trabajos de la literatura moderna debido a su premisa única y sus mordaces peripecias de la vida familiar.

(Prague, Austro-Hungarian Empire, 1883 - Kierling, Austria, 1924) Bohemian writer in German language. His work, among the most influential in world literature, is a pioneer in the fusion of realistic elements with fantastic ones and focuses mainly on father-son conflicts, anxiety, existentialism, physical and psychological brutality, guilt, the philosophy of the absurd, bureaucracy, and spiritual transformations. He wrote notable novels and a large number of short stories, and also left behind extensive correspondence and autobiographical writings. His unique literary style has often been associated with the artistic philosophy of existentialism and expressionism. His personal relationships also had a significant impact on his writing. The term Kafkaesque is used in Spanish to describe bizarre situations, due to their absurdity and distressing nature.
